Dial “M” for Merthyr: The Top of the D meets Sarah Thomas.
Sarah Thomas is Welsh Hockey’s golden girl. The country’s only representative in both Men’s and Women’s Great Britain squads at London 2012 and the first Welsh outfield player to compete at consecutive Olympic games, it is fair to say the former Rotterdam forward has a lot to be proud of. The Top of the D Meets: Darren Cheesman.
Darren Cheesman is a very interesting character. A product of the Arsenal “In the community scheme” his life could easily have taken a wrong turn and ended up very different but for his involvement in hockey. He’s spent a year playing in Holland, scooped the English Premier League Player of the Year in 2008 and scored on his Great Britain debut in 2010. He is by no means finished there, however. Maxifuel Supersixes Men’s Final: East Grinstead 7-1 Reading.
East Grinstead won their fifth National Indoor title in a row with a hugely impressive display to overcome old foes Reading at Wembley this afternoon.
